A wheel bearing is a crucial component of your vehicle's suspension system, allowing the wheels to rotate smoothly and freely. It consists of a pair of bearings that are pressed into the bearing hub, which is then attached to the wheel. The hub bearing is made up of two sets of bearings: inner and outer bearings. The inner bearings are pressed into the bearing hub, while the outer bearings are pressed into the wheel.

The choice between traditional wheel bearings and hub bearings depends on various factors. Here's a comparison of their pros and cons:
Characteristic | Wheel Bearings | Hub Bearings |
---|---|---|
Ease of replacement | Easier to replace individual bearings | More complex replacement process |
Cost | Generally cheaper to replace | More expensive to replace |
Durability | Less durable; prone to early failure | More durable; longer lifespan |
Serviceability | Can be rebuilt or repacked | Not easily serviceable; replacement required |
Suitability | Suitable for older, non-ABS vehicles | Ideal for modern vehicles with ABS and stability control systems |

Symptom | Possible Cause |
---|---|
Humming or growling noise while driving | Worn-out bearings |
Excessive vibration, especially at higher speeds | Worn-out or damaged bearings |
Uneven tire wear | Misalignment caused by worn bearings |
Loose or wobbly wheel | Damaged bearings or loose hub bolts |
Difficulty steering or braking | Severe bearing damage |
